I Also find duos easier than squads if I can be bothered to play it as it's boring. Solos is just life sucking.

I tend to agree regarding solos in that I find it really hard to pluck up the motivation to start a game, but once I'm into it and progressing towards the last 20 or so I find myself totally engrossed, more so than squads, its pretty intense because nobody is there to rescue you or back you up.

I think the teamwork is better in duos as there are only two of you, squads can be a bit more frustrating in that respect as your team mates tend to care less about the value of your life. If one person gets killed in duos that's half your effective fighting force gone, with squads, people tend to shrug a bit more as its only a quarter lost.

No, that's incorrect.

There's an opposing scenario which switches that totally around.
Lets say you drop first, kill 3 out of 4 guys from an opposing team, it's now fundamentally easier for you to win, especially if this has happened elsewhere.
Another scenario, lets say you have a full squad of 4 for the entire match, there's another team killing everyone else, reducing everyone else's team to a single player. You are now in a stupidly strong position, against teams of 1.

We're not talking about 1-man-squads, where you always starts solo vs squads, we're talking about squads vs squads. Maths alone says that mode is the easiest. When working with statistics, you can't take into account everything and you only work with what you know. What you do know is it's 4 vs 96 at worst case, which where you're 1 out of 25 squads. 1/25 is much better odds than 1/100.
